Recent Lombardy Review: "At the risk of repeating, this is not a standard hotel but a building of high-quality condos that are rented out when the owners don't need them. They all have full but small kitchens. The establishment has all the standard hotel amenities, except a lobby lounge temporarily (see below). Our main concern when staying at hotel in a big city is noise. This place is extremely QUIET and actually restful. We had a King Suite that was very spacious and well-appointed, especially the bathroom. The staff were gracious and responsive; housekeeping was great. This is a high-class place all around. The neighborhood is reputable (between Park and Lexington, not far from Central Park) and quiet (by NYC standards). Why would one stay in a standard hotel in the Times Square area when you can stay here for a similar pricer The Italian restaurant across the street is excellent. The lobby is under construction (behind a wall; we never heard any noise), so there is no lobby lounge at present, but we didn't care about that. Parking is less expensive than typical for good quality NYC hotels. A gem."

Some of NYC’s best-known landmarks are north of 14th and south of 59th—or Midtown Manhattan. Here, couples kiss atop the Empire State Building. Grand Central Station’s opal-faced clock is a famed meeting spot. While fortunes are made on Wall Street, fortunes are spent at Fifth Avenue’s shops. Other highlights include Madison Square Garden, the United Nations, and the Garment and Diamond districts.

A prestigious Midtown location, gracious service, and surprisingly spacious rooms--you'll find all this and more at The Lombardy. This small hotel is just off elegant Park Avenue, with some of the city's most notable shopping tantalizingly close. Fifth Avenue, a 5-minute walk, is lined with world-renowned retailers like Tiffany & Co., Saks Fifth Avenue, and Bergdorf Goodman. Surprise your kids with a toy from FAO Schwarz, at Fifth Avenue and East 58th Street. Then walk 1 block farther to Central Park--pure fun for all ages. Rockefeller Center, St. Patrick's Cathedral, the Museum of Modern Art…they're all within a 10-minute stroll. If you're venturing farther afield, you can catch a subway less than 4 blocks away. The Lombardy was built in 1926 by publishing magnate William Randolph Hearst, and its pedigree shows from the moment you arrive. You'll be welcomed by uniformed door staff and whisked up to your room by a white-gloved elevator attendant. The staff even includes a tailor and a valet. Start your day with a complimentary continental breakfast, served in the Martini Bistro. Later, the bistro provides a sophisticated setting for light bites, wine, and cocktails, including, of course, a selection of martinis. The Lombardy's hair salon and fitness center can help you look and feel your best. You can stay in touch with complimentary wireless Internet access, available throughout the hotel. No laptop? No problem. The business center is available 24 hours a day. Your Hotel Rooms's size will be generous--and so will the amenities. Stash your luggage in the walk-in closet and relax in front of the HDTV, which comes with premium cable channels, including HBO. You can whip up a snack in the kitchenette area--it includes a microwave, refrigerator, and dishes. Plush terry bathrobes help you relax in style. Telephones come with voice mail, but you can also opt to have your messages delivered by the bellhop. Some rooms have been equipped for the convenience and accessibility of disabled guests.
